SSIS-641: A Comprehensive Guide to Understanding and Implementing SQL Server Integration Services (64-bit)

SQL Server Integration Services (SSIS) is a robust platform that enables organizations to build data integration solutions efficiently. SSIS-641 specifically refers to the 64-bit version of this powerful tool, which is essential for handling large-scale data processing and complex ETL (Extract, Transform, Load) workflows. Whether you're a data engineer, database administrator, or a developer, understanding SSIS-641 is crucial for leveraging its capabilities in modern data environments.

SSIS-641 has become a cornerstone for businesses that require advanced data integration solutions. With the increasing volume of data and the demand for real-time analytics, organizations need tools that can handle large datasets effectively. SSIS-641 provides the necessary framework to streamline data migration, transformation, and loading processes, making it an invaluable asset for data professionals.

In this article, we will explore the intricacies of SSIS-641, including its features, benefits, implementation strategies, and best practices. By the end of this guide, you will have a comprehensive understanding of how SSIS-641 can enhance your data integration processes and contribute to your organization's success.

Table of Contents

Introduction to SSIS-641

SSIS-641 is the 64-bit version of SQL Server Integration Services, a component of Microsoft SQL Server designed for data integration and workflow automation. It allows users to perform a wide range of data integration tasks, such as extracting data from various sources, transforming it into a usable format, and loading it into target systems. This version is specifically optimized for handling large datasets and resource-intensive operations, making it ideal for enterprise-level applications.

SSIS-641 offers several advantages over its 32-bit counterpart, including enhanced performance, scalability, and support for modern data processing requirements. By leveraging the power of 64-bit architecture, SSIS-641 can efficiently manage memory-intensive tasks and process large volumes of data without compromising performance.

Why Choose SSIS-641?

SSIS-641 is a preferred choice for organizations that require a reliable and scalable solution for their data integration needs. Some of the key reasons for choosing SSIS-641 include:

  • Improved performance for large-scale data processing.
  • Compatibility with modern data sources and formats.
  • Advanced features for data transformation and cleansing.
  • Integration with other Microsoft products, such as SQL Server and Azure.

Key Features of SSIS-641

SSIS-641 comes equipped with a variety of features that make it a versatile and powerful tool for data integration. Below are some of its most notable features:

  • Data Flow Task: Enables seamless data extraction, transformation, and loading processes.
  • Control Flow Task: Facilitates the orchestration of tasks and workflows within the SSIS package.
  • Event Handlers: Allows users to define actions to be taken in response to specific events during package execution.
  • Variables and Parameters: Provides a way to store and manage dynamic values within SSIS packages.

Advanced Data Transformation Capabilities

SSIS-641 offers a wide range of data transformation components that enable users to manipulate and clean data effectively. These components include:

  • Data Conversion
  • Aggregate
  • Lookup
  • Derived Column

Benefits of Using SSIS-641

Adopting SSIS-641 can bring numerous benefits to organizations looking to enhance their data integration capabilities. Some of the key benefits include:

  • Performance Optimization: SSIS-641 is designed to handle large datasets with ease, ensuring optimal performance even under heavy workloads.
  • Scalability: Its 64-bit architecture allows SSIS-641 to scale seamlessly, accommodating growing data volumes and processing requirements.
  • Cost-Effectiveness: By leveraging existing Microsoft infrastructure, organizations can reduce costs associated with implementing third-party ETL tools.

Enhanced Security Features

SSIS-641 includes robust security features that protect sensitive data throughout the integration process. These features ensure compliance with industry standards and regulations, such as GDPR and HIPAA.

SSIS-641 Architecture

The architecture of SSIS-641 is designed to support complex data integration workflows. It consists of several key components, including:

  • Integration Services Service: Manages the execution of SSIS packages on the server.
  • SSIS Catalog: Provides a centralized repository for storing and managing SSIS packages.
  • SSIS Designer: A graphical interface for designing and developing SSIS packages.

Integration with Azure

SSIS-641 integrates seamlessly with Microsoft Azure, enabling users to leverage cloud-based services for data integration. This integration allows organizations to take advantage of Azure's scalability and flexibility, further enhancing their data processing capabilities.

Installation and Configuration

Installing and configuring SSIS-641 requires careful planning and execution. Below are the steps involved in setting up SSIS-641:

  • Prerequisites: Ensure that the necessary prerequisites, such as .NET Framework and SQL Server, are installed on the target system.
  • Installation: Follow the installation wizard to install SSIS-641 on your server.
  • Configuration: Configure the SSIS Catalog and set up security settings to ensure proper functioning.

Best Practices for Installation

To ensure a successful installation and configuration of SSIS-641, consider the following best practices:

  • Plan your installation carefully, taking into account the specific requirements of your organization.
  • Test the installation in a development environment before deploying it to production.
  • Document the installation process and configuration settings for future reference.

Common Use Cases

SSIS-641 is widely used across various industries for a range of data integration tasks. Some common use cases include:

  • Data Migration
  • Data Warehousing
  • ETL Processing
  • Real-Time Data Integration

Data Migration with SSIS-641

SSIS-641 is particularly well-suited for data migration projects, where large volumes of data need to be transferred between systems. Its robust features and scalability make it an ideal choice for such tasks.

Best Practices for SSIS-641

To get the most out of SSIS-641, it's essential to follow best practices for development and deployment. Some of these practices include:

  • Modular Design: Break down complex workflows into smaller, manageable components.
  • Error Handling: Implement robust error handling mechanisms to ensure smooth execution.
  • Documentation: Maintain thorough documentation of your SSIS packages for future reference.

Performance Optimization Techniques

Optimizing the performance of SSIS-641 packages is crucial for ensuring efficient data processing. Techniques such as parallel execution and buffer management can significantly enhance performance.

Troubleshooting SSIS-641

Like any software, SSIS-641 may encounter issues during execution. Below are some common troubleshooting tips:

  • Check the event logs for detailed error messages.
  • Use the SSIS Debugger to identify and resolve issues.
  • Consult the official Microsoft documentation for guidance on specific errors.

Common Errors and Solutions

Some common errors encountered in SSIS-641 and their solutions include:

  • Connection Errors: Verify connection strings and ensure proper access permissions.
  • Memory Issues: Optimize package settings to reduce memory usage.

Comparison with Other ETL Tools

While SSIS-641 is a powerful ETL tool, it's important to compare it with other options available in the market. Below is a comparison with some popular ETL tools:

  • Talend: Open-source and highly customizable, but may require additional setup for enterprise use.
  • Informatica: Feature-rich and widely used in enterprise environments, but can be costly.

Why Choose SSIS-641?

SSIS-641 stands out due to its seamless integration with Microsoft products, cost-effectiveness, and robust feature set. For organizations already using Microsoft SQL Server, SSIS-641 is often the preferred choice for data integration.

Future of SSIS-641

As data integration requirements continue to evolve, so too will SSIS-641. Future developments may include enhanced cloud integration, improved performance, and additional features to support emerging data trends.

Innovation in Data Integration

SSIS-641 is poised to play a key role in driving innovation in the field of data integration. By staying ahead of industry trends and incorporating cutting-edge technologies, SSIS-641 will continue to be a vital tool for data professionals.

Conclusion

SSIS-641 is a powerful and versatile tool for data integration, offering a wide range of features and benefits for organizations of all sizes. By understanding its capabilities and following best practices, you can leverage SSIS-641 to enhance your data processing workflows and drive business success.

We invite you to share your thoughts and experiences with SSIS-641 in the comments section below. Additionally, feel free to explore other articles on our site for more insights into data integration and related topics. Thank you for reading!

References:

  • Microsoft Docs - SQL Server Integration Services
  • SQL Server Blog - SSIS Best Practices
  • SQL Shack - SSIS Performance Optimization

You Might Also Like